
by Daniel Joslyn-Siemiatkoski
"This book examines late antique and medieval devotional texts and materials, ranging from the eastern Mediterranean to northwestern Europe, related to the Maccabean martyrs - Jews who died for the Mosaic Law before the birth of Jesus. Daniel Joslyn-Siemiatkoski demonstrates here that Christian thinkers constructed memories of the Maccabean martyrs that simultaneously appropriated Jewish traditions and obscured the Jewish origins of Christianity."--BOOK JACKET.
